With 10 years of experience as an occupational therapist, Josefine Dunn has built a diverse and rich career working in various therapeutic settings across the United States as a traveling therapist. Throughout her career, she has had the unique opportunity to gain expertise in a wide range of environments, further honing her skills in patient care and rehabilitation. In addition to her extensive occupational therapy background, Josefine is a certified lymphedema therapist, a specialization that enhances her ability to support individuals with lymphatic conditions.
Currently residing in Golden, Colorado, with her husband and their 14-year-old golden retriever, Josefine enjoys an active lifestyle that includes hiking, biking, skiing, and spending time on the water.
